Absorbent Gelling Fiber Dressing Carboxymethyl Cellulose (CMC) 6 X 6 Inch, 5/BX

This absorbent gelling fiber dressing is a sterile CMC wound dressing sized 6 x 6 inch. It may be used during the healing process of decubitus ulcers, venous and arterial leg ulcers, diabetic ulcers, graft and donor sites, post-operative surgical wounds, superficial and partial thickness burns, and cavity wounds. Buyers looking for a highly absorbent square dressing may value its wet and dry strength and its support for a moist wound environment.

Key Features

  • Absorbent gelling fiber dressing for wound care applications
  • Carboxymethyl cellulose CMC construction
  • Highly absorbent to help manage wound fluid
  • Excellent wet and dry strength for handling during use
  • Supports a moist wound environment with low risk of maceration
  • Sterile 6 x 6 inch square dressing
